Economy Minister Dilov Meets Cuban Ambassador to Discuss Deeper Trade Links
Economy Minister Dilov Meets Cuban Ambassador to Discuss Deeper Trade Links
Meeting between Economy Minister Dilov and the Ambassador of the Republic of Cuba to Bulgaria Marieta Garcia Jordan, Ministry of Economy, Sofia, June 20, 2025 (Ministry of Economy and Industry Photo)

Minister of Economy and Industry Peter Dilov and Ambassador of the Republic of Cuba to Bulgaria Marieta Garcia Jordan discussed opportunities to deepen bilateral trade and strengthen economic cooperation, the Ministry of Economy said in a press release on Friday. The meeting focused on achieving more tangible progress in relations between the two countries.

The possibilities for expanding bilateral trade and economic cooperation were discussed. Dilov noted the significant growth in bilateral trade in 2024, which has increased by more than 46% compared with the previous year. “It is necessary to seek opportunities to diversify products by focusing on those with higher added value,” he said. 

For her part, Garcia Jordan underlined the long-standing tradition of friendly relations between the two countries.

Both agreed that opportunities exist for mutually beneficial cooperation in a number of areas, including in line with Bulgaria’s membership in the European Union and the Republic of Cuba’s membership in the Latin American Integration Association and other regional organizations.

The meeting was also attended by Deputy Ministers of Economy and Industry Nevena Lazarova and Doncho Barbalov.
